Grubhub has launched a new integration with OpenAI's ChatGPT, enabling users to search for meal ideas and seamlessly complete orders through the AI chatbot. This development follows Grubhub's $650 million acquisition by food-tech startup Wonder and marks a significant technical advancement for the company. The feature is available across Grubhub's extensive network of 415,000 restaurant partners nationwide.
The integration aims to enhance the user experience by providing a more personalized, conversational method for users to choose meals based on their mood, dietary preferences, or group dynamics. Tapojoy Chatterjee, vice president of product management at Grubhub and Wonder, emphasized the value of this integration, stating, "The best dining experiences always start with discovery, and we are constantly looking for ways to meet Grubhub customers wherever they are."
From a business perspective, this new feature is designed to benefit Grubhub's merchant partners by connecting them with potential customers earlier in the decision-making process, thereby capturing high-intent demand. Users of ChatGPT can now browse real-time restaurant options and menu items before being redirected to Grubhub to complete their orders. This move is expected to provide Grubhub with a competitive edge in the food delivery market, particularly among tech-savvy consumers who are increasingly reliant on AI for everyday tasks.
